EASY plug Active Buzzer Module


Introduction

Hey want to hear a really loud noise? Apply 3.3V to 5V to this buzzer module and you'll be rewarded with a loud beep.
Here is the simplest sound making module. You can use high/low level to drive it. Just change the frequency it buzzes, you can hear different sound.
It is really great for integrating into projects with this small but useful module. Have a try! You will find the electronic sound it creates so fascinating.
This module is widely used on your daily appliance, like PC, refrigerator, phones, etc.
Note: this module should be used together with EASY plug control board.


Specification

  • Interface: Easy plug
  • Working voltage: 3.3-5V
  • Sensor type: digital
  • Easy to use


Technical Details

  • Dimensions: 39mm*20mm*18mm
  • Weight: 5.6g


Connect It Up

Connect the EASY Plug passive buzzer module to control board using an RJ11 cable. Then connect the control board to your PC with a USB cable.

Sample Code

Copy and paste below code to Arduino IDE and upload.

int buzzer=8;//set digital IO pin of the buzzer
void setup()
{
pinMode(buzzer,OUTPUT);// set digital IO pin pattern, OUTPUT to be output
}
void loop()
{ unsigned char i,j;//define variable
while(1)
{ for(i=0;i<80;i++)// output a frequency sound
{ digitalWrite(buzzer,HIGH);// sound
delay(1);//delay1ms
digitalWrite(buzzer,LOW);//not sound
delay(1);//ms delay
}
for(i=0;i<100;i++)// output a frequency sound
{
digitalWrite(buzzer,HIGH);// sound
digitalWrite(buzzer,LOW);//not sound
delay(2);//2ms delay
}
}
}


What You Should See

Done uploading the code, you should be able to hear the buzzer module make a small “click”.
